V2 box + gears issues
10 November, 2011, 04:55
I'm currently doing up the gearbox in my mate's TM MP5 after his high speed setup vaporised the internals.
Just ordered in some replacement parts and I'm having a bit of a compatibility issue between them.
Gearbox casing: Systema 7mm V2
New gears: Guarder Infinite Torque
Old gears: No idea, totally unusable
Old bearings: Totally unusable
Now, the new Guarder gears will not fit in the bushings, not without considerable force.
When the spur gear is in place, it's edge grates against the walls of the cutout for it.
I tested a few things with the old components (what could be salvaged for testing purposes) and found out:
- New gears will not fit inside new bushings or the old bearings
- Old gears will fit inside new bushings
But suppose I get a different set of bushings (with no guarantee they'll fit either) that will still leave me with the contact between the spur gear and the casing.
Or I could order in another brand new set of gears and hope they'll fit both the bushings and the gearbox case.
What do you think is my best bet? I need this ready to go for Sunday so if it's new parts, I'll need to order them today to get them in time.
Ideally I'd like to make do with the existing parts, I figured drilling out the bearings the tiniest bit might be the way to go. However that still leaves me with the spur gear issue. Also, if I drill slightly biased to one side, it'll throw the entire gear alignment setup to crap.
Thoughts and input much appreciated

Re: V2 box + gears issues
Different gears! I had the same problem-could'nt get the guarder sector gear to fit into any 7mm or 8mm bearings(KA/G+P/VFC),thought of guarder bushings but could only find them in 6mm. In your position I would'nt go drilling the bushings I'd reckon I'd be digging the hole deeper! Almost every other set will fit the systema casing.Just MY thoughts but am'nt in YOUR shoes right now!
